1第一章 微机原理及接口技术

1第一章 微机原理及接口技术

ID:24996662

大小:180.00 KB

页数:25页

时间:2018-11-17

1第一章 微机原理及接口技术_第1页
1第一章 微机原理及接口技术_第2页
1第一章 微机原理及接口技术_第3页
1第一章 微机原理及接口技术_第4页
1第一章 微机原理及接口技术_第5页
资源描述:

《1第一章 微机原理及接口技术》由会员上传分享,免费在线阅读,更多相关内容在学术论文-天天文库

1、微机原理及接口技术第一讲概述I/O接口电路及与外设的连接硬件--接口电路原理软件--接口编程方法微机原理及接口技术典型机型:IBMPC系列机基本系统:8088CPU和半导体存储器课程内容硬件内容8086/8微处理器功能结构8086/8微处理器引脚功能功能模块及接口技术软件内容8086指令系统汇编语言程序设计先修课程及学习要求数字电路——硬件理解的基础熟练掌握微处理器的功能结构掌握微处理器的引脚功能熟记指令的格式理解基本含义掌握汇编语言程序设计的基本方法掌握接口技术学习方法与考核复习并掌握先修课的有关内容课堂:听讲与理解、做好笔记课后:认真复习、完成作业实

2、验:充分准备、做好实验写好报告总成绩=期末考试*75%+平时*10%+实验成绩*15%第1章微型计算机系统概述教学重点1、微型计算机的系统组成,微处理器的内部结构2、8086/8微处理器的组成及存储器组织3、8086/8CPU的两种工作模式4、8086/8088CPU的外部结构及引脚功能5、时序的概念及典型时序分析1.1微型计算机的发展和应用1、1946年,世界上出现第一台数字式电子计算机,发展到了以大规模集成电路为主要部件的微型计算机2、1971年,Intel公司设计了世界上第一个微处理器芯片Intel4004,开创了一个全新的计算机时代1.1.1微型

3、计算机的发展1、第1代:4位和低档8位微机4004→4040→80082、第2代:中高档8位微机Z80、I8085、M6800,Apple-II微机3、第3代:1978年,Intel公司推出了16位处理器8086(时钟频率为4~8MHz),集成度为2万~6万管/片。8086的内部和外部数据总线16位,地址总线20位,可直接访问1MB内存单元。其简化芯片80881.1.1微型计算机的发展(续)4、第4代:32位微机Intel推出了32位处理器80386(时钟频率为20MHZ),其内外部数据线和地址总线都是32位,可访问4GB内存,支持分页机制。5、第5代:

4、64位微机Itanium、64位RISC微处理器芯片微机服务器、工程工作站、图形工作站1.1.2微型计算机的应用1、用于数值计算、数据处理及信息管理方向通用微机,例如:PC微机功能越强越好、使用越方便越好2、用于过程控制及智能化仪器仪表方向专用微机,例如:单片机、专用微处理器可靠性高、实时性强程序相对简单、处理数据量小图1.1微型计算机的系统组成控制总线CB数据总线DB地址总线AB总线接口处理器子系统I/O设备I/O接口存储器系统总线BUS1.2.1微型计算机的硬件组成1、微处理器子系统2、存储器3、I/O设备和I/O接口4、系统总线系统总线1、总线是指

5、传递信息的一组公用导线2、总线是传送信息的公共通道3、微机系统采用总线结构连接系统功能部件4、总线信号可分成三组地址总线AB:传送地址信息数据总线DB:传送数据信息控制总线CB:传送控制信息总线信号1、地址总线AB输出将要访问的内存单元或I/O端口的地址地址线的多少决定了系统直接寻址存储器的范围2、数据总线DBCPU读操作时,外部数据通过数据总线送往CPUCPU写操作时,CPU数据通过数据总线送往外部数据线的多少决定了一次能够传送数据的位数3、控制总线CB协调系统中各部件的操作,有输出控制、输入状态等信号控制总线决定了系统总线的特点,例如功能、适应性等1

6、.2.2微型计算机的软件系统操作系统MS-DOS汇编程序MASM和LINK文本编辑程序EDIT.COM调试程序DEBUG.EXE1.3IBMPC系列机系统8088CPU1.3.18088微处理器8088微处理器8087协处理器8288总线控制器I/O通道8259中断控制器随机存储器RAM只读存储器ROM8253定时控制器8237DMA控制器8255并行接口控制总线数据总线地址总线地址锁存器数据收发器扬声器接口8284时钟发生器键盘接口系统配置开关1.3.2主机板组成8086/8088微处理器:16位内部结构、16/8位数据总线、20位地址总线、4.77M

7、Hz主频1、存储器ROM-BIOS、主体为RAM2、I/O接口控制电路8259A、8253、8237A、8255等3、I/O通道62线的IBMPC总线1.3.3典型16位微处理器结构(1)、累加器和算术逻辑运算部件主要用来完成数据的算术和逻辑运算。参加运算的操作数在ALU中进行规定的操作运算,运算结束后,将结果送至累加器的同时将操作结果的特征状态送标志寄存器。累加器是一个特殊的寄存器,它的字长和微处理器的字长相同,累加器具有输入/输出和移位功能,微处理器采用累加器结构可以简化某些逻辑运算。(2)、寄存器阵列①通用寄存器组②地址寄存器③指令指针IP④变址寄

8、存器SI,DI⑤堆栈指示器SP(3)、指令寄存器,指令译码器和定时及各种控制信号

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。